ISCO International Announces Special Investor Call for June 5, 2008 at 4:30pm (Eastern) to Review Its Plan

ELK GROVE VILLAGE, IL -- 05/23/2008 -- ISCO International, Inc. (AMEX: ISO), a leading supplier of RF management and interference-control solutions for the wireless telecommunications industry, announced an upcoming special investor call to review its business plan.

"I indicated during our May 7th quarterly conference call that we would hold a special investor call to review our business plan once it was finalized," said Gordon Reichard, Jr., CEO of ISCO. "That process is now complete, and I believe we have a sound plan for execution. We will hold a special investor call on Thursday, June 5, 2008, at 4:30pm eastern (3:30pm central), to go through the plan together and answer investor questions. I believe our investors should have a clear understanding regarding what we intend to accomplish and how we intend to do it. I understand that visual aids have not traditionally been employed. That is changing at this time. I encourage anyone interested in the slide presentation to connect using the webcast."
